Stranglehold delayed

John Woo's 2007.

Midway has decided to keep John Woo's Stranglehold in development for a bit longer, with the release date now set to be sometime in Q1 2007.

The delay comes on the back of a very positive reception at this year's E3, where the game was billed as one of the next generation's most interesting prospects.

It's currently in development at Midway's Chicago studio, and due out on PlayStation 3, Xbox 360 and PC.
